Skip to main content

Payment Status

Description: Retrieves the current processing status of a previously initiated transaction.

GET /api/v1/epapss/payments/{reference}

Use Cases

  • Network timeout recovery
  • Customer dispute resolution
  • Transaction reconciliation
  • Pending transaction tracking
GET {base_url}/api/v1/epapss/payments/CUD176355628318266
{
"code": "0",
"data": {
"amount": 30.0,
"completedAt": "2026-06-02T13:43:34.496Z",
"currency": "NGN",
"destination": {
"accountNumber": "0019418421",
"bankCode": "044",
"country": "NG"
},
"processingStage": "PAPSS_PROCESSING_TXN",
"providerReference": "CUD1780407814481159",
"source": {
"accountNumber": "2378920",
"bankCode": "044"
},
"transactionReference": "23678912376",
"transactionStatus": "SUCCESS"
},
"message": "successful",
"requestId": "REQ_20260604080516",
"status": "completed"
}